Description
The Barolo Perno Vigna Disa Riserva by Elio Sandri is a red wine of great character, produced with Nebbiolo grapes from the historic Vigna Disa located in the Perno hamlet, in the municipality of Monforte d'Alba. The production approach reflects a vision deeply rooted in Langhe tradition, with particular attention to the expression of the territory and the preservation of the varietal identity of Nebbiolo.
Fermentation takes place in concrete tanks with spontaneous fermentations activated by indigenous yeasts, while ageing occurs in large oak barrels for an extended period, allowing the wine to develop complexity and depth. This traditional method ensures a faithful expression of the cru of origin, with a slow and harmonious evolution over time.
On the palate, the wine is powerful yet balanced, with a layered and dynamic structure. The aromas recall ripe red fruits, sweet spices, balsamic notes, and earthy nuances, while the palate reveals dense and well-integrated tannins, refined elegance, and a pleasant ease of drinking despite the overall intensity.
It pairs magnificently with game dishes, stews, or blue and spicy cheeses.
